Noise

Refrigerators can produce many different sounds while operating, some of which are more obvious than others. If you notice any of the noises below find out the cause and search for a fix before calling a repair company for your fridge.

Rattling

The fridge could rattle if there is not enough space between it and the wall or cabinet or if its sitting at an unlevel angle. It's easy to repair. It's all you need to do is ensure that there is at least two inches between the fridge and the wall or cabinet, or adjust the leveling screws or legs to raise or lower your fridge.

Hissing

The compressor may hiss when cooling your food. This is normal, and it's caused by the compressor oil or flow of refrigerant flowing through the system. If you're concerned, time how often the compressor cycles and call a fridge repair service immediately if it does so more frequently than usual.

Squeaking

Refrigerators can sound raucous if the coils or fan are filthy. If you hear a loud squeaking sound from your refrigerator, you can use the brush attachment of a vacuum cleaner or a rag along with dish soap or water along with warm water to wash the coils and fan. This should be done twice each year, or more often in the case of older refrigerators or heavily used.

Condenser Coils

If refrigerators function properly, the coils best deals on fridge the front and back of the appliance should dissipate the heat produced by the compressor. However, when these radiator-like components are covered with dust, pet hair or lint, the compressor will work all day long trying to cool the fridge and will eventually wear down the appliance. It's important to regularly clean your coils.

If you're planning to do the work yourself It is recommended that you disconnect the refrigerator and switch off the power source prior to starting. This can reduce the risk of electrocuting yourself and your family members while working on the appliance. If you are allergic to dust, it's an ideal idea to wear a face mask. You'll then have to find the coils. They are typically located in the rear of the fridge or at the front across the base in some units. If you're unsure of where to find them check the owner's manual or contact the manufacturer for more information.

Once you've located the coils, take off the access panel (if there's one) and alternate between vacuuming them using the narrow hose attachment or brushing them using a condenser cleaning brush. It is important to take your time when doing this so that you don't bend or damaging the coils. Replace the kick panel or move the refrigerator to its position, then plug it in.

Maintenance

Refrigerators are durable appliances that keep running throughout the day and night to cool your food. They require regular maintenance to ensure they perform their job well. Simple preventive maintenance can ensure that your machines are running efficiently for a long time.

One easy thing to do is to clean the door seals. Jelly and other food items that stick can cause a buildup and stop the gaskets from securing tightly and allowing cool air to escape through tiny gaps. Every few months, clean them clean using a baking soda solution and warm water with a toothbrush or sponge.
